Measured in base pairs (bp) — the individual letters of DNA (human ≈ 3.2 Gb, a bacterium a few million). The chart places this genome on a logarithmic scale — each step to the right is ten times bigger — among reference organisms. Across species a bigger genome loosely tracks with larger cells, slower growth and lower-energy lifestyles (powered flight favours small genomes) — yet it does not imply more genes or a more advanced organism (the long-standing C-value paradox).

Assembly level tells you how finished the sequence is — from fragmented contigs, through scaffolds, up to a full chromosome-level assembly. BUSCO % estimates completeness: the share of genes expected to be present that were actually found. These describe the data quality, not the organism.
